team leader

Responsibility

  • you will manage the Intake of cats and dogs to the charity and oversee their subsequent rehoming
  • you will be expected to demonstrate evidence-based decision-making and to undertake appropriate CPD to maintain up-to-date knowledge
  • the primary purpose of this role is to provide supervision and leadership to the Small Animal Team and ensure that the welfare of the animals in their care is maintained to a high standard
  • the role is a hands-on role and will work closely with our veterinary partners to ensure that care and treatment reflects industry best-practice
  • reporting directly to the Head of Animal Welfare you will be responsible for your department’s budget, reporting and staff appraisals and record keeping
  • you must be committed to maximizing the effectiveness and reputation of the Charity through highly professional standards of conduct, team-working and customer service at all times and be proactively supportive of colleagues and inter-departmental working
  • you will contribute proactively to the development and improvement of policies, practices, methods and standards at the Charity
  • as part of the role the post holder will also be involved in the rehoming process, caseworking animals as part of the team

Requirements

  • animal care/management qualification or significant, demonstrable experience of welfare management
  • proven background in leading a successful team
  • non-judgemental approach and excellent customer service skills
  • experience of working with nervous/shutdown/aggressive animals
  • experience and confidence in handling strong and large dogs
  • confident and competent in medicating cats and dogs
